H3 Athletix events are designed to create high-energy, professionally organized athletic experiences for youth and amateur athletes, families, coaches, sponsors, and community partners. Our programming may include tournaments, showcases, camps, clinics, combine-style evaluations, training events, and community sports experiences that give athletes an opportunity to compete, develop, gain exposure, and be part of a positive event environment.
The goal of each H3 Athletix event is to deliver more than just games or sessions. We aim to create a full event experience that includes organized competition, athlete development, family engagement, media coverage, branding opportunities, sponsor visibility, and a strong community atmosphere. Depending on the event format, hosts may see a mix of athletes, coaches, spectators, vendors, trainers, photographers, videographers, and event staff on site.
H3 Athletix is focused on building events that are well-run, safe, family-friendly, and valuable for both participants and host communities. We are looking for host partners that can help us provide quality facilities, smooth operations, and a welcoming environment. In return, our events are intended to drive facility usage, bring families and teams into the area, create local economic activity, and strengthen the host’s reputation as a destination for competitive youth and amateur sports.
H3 Athletix is seeking host partners that can support flexible event timing based on the size, format, and schedule of each event. Timing needs may include full-day, multi-day, weekend, evening, or seasonal event windows depending on the program. We are especially interested in venues that can accommodate setup time before the event, competition or programming time during the event, and breakdown time after the event concludes.
Preferred availability would include access to the facility early enough for staff arrival, registration setup, vendor/sponsor setup, signage placement, equipment staging, and athlete check-in before participants arrive. For larger events, we may require access the day before the event for load-in, court or field setup, branding, walkthroughs, and operational preparation.
Event schedules may include morning through evening programming, with flexibility for staggered start times, multiple waves of athletes, team check-ins, warm-ups, awards, media coverage, and post-event cleanup. H3 Athletix values facilities that can provide clear availability windows, reasonable setup and breakdown access, and flexibility to adjust timing based on registration numbers, event flow, and participant experience.
